At its February meeting near Tallahassee, the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ission (FWC) approved regionally-specific bay scallop open season dates for 2018, including a change to the season for Levy, Citrus and Hernando counties that was proposed in December.

The Commission also approved a trial bay scallop season in state waters off Pasco County in 2018. On Tuesday, Citrus County Commission Chairman Ron Kitchen detailed the background for the scallop season process for 2018.
